Output 676580f09fa49eb31d1b45f38d603c35b13894c3b85d8b7127d5b9e68fc371ac:5

value
629963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6be8bcdf3dba95e29fd5e417dd3be7a55a2b0de8 OP_EQUAL
address
3BXb2yTJvAGjZvAohHAxcLHMfqMvfDqZGD
transaction
676580f09fa49eb31d1b45f38d603c35b13894c3b85d8b7127d5b9e68fc371ac
spent
true